The car has just a bit of understeer, just to be safe, but the back end can come out if I'm sloppy or if I want it to come out.
As for the drilling, it was just two new holes in the subframe for the bigger brackets. I've heard people say that it was a bolt-on affair, but I don't know what the deal was with mine. The box said it was for 94-00 integra, 92-95 civic, and a del sol of some sort. I don't know, but it doesn't matter, the install was fairly easy, regardless.
